What is Prompt Engineering?
At its core, prompt engineering refers to the practice of crafting inputs or queries to guide AI systems in producing desired outputs. This can involve:
- Defining clear and specific instructions.
- Using contextually rich language.
- Iterating on prompts to refine results.
The goal is to steer the AI in a productive direction, maximizing its creative capabilities while minimizing ambiguity.

The Perils of Poor Prompt Engineering
While proficient prompt engineering can unleash great creativity, errors in this craft can lead to disastrous outcomes. Poorly formulated prompts might yield:
- Inaccurate Outputs: Misinformation or irrelevant content can occur when prompts lack clarity.
- Bias Reinforcement: AI systems may perpetuate stereotypes or biases if prompted inadequately.
- Ethical Dilemmas: Misguided prompts can lead to outputs that challenge moral boundaries, creating scenarios where AI generates harmful or inappropriate content.

Balancing Creativity and Control
The question turns: how do we harness the power of AI through prompt engineering without losing sight of our goals? Here are some strategies:
- Iterate and Test: Continuously refine your prompts based on the feedback from AI outputs.
- Educate Users: Equip team members and stakeholders with the skills they need to craft effective prompts.
- Establish Guidelines: Create a framework for ethical and responsible prompt creation.
Ultimately, the balance between creativity and control lies in the hands of the human user, advocating for a mindfully crafted approach to AI interactions.
